The Beerschoten estate is located near the city of Utrecht. With winding ponds, a flowing stream, meadows with groups of trees and old avenues, it is an attractive walking area. The adjacent Houdringe consists of forest and open grassland. There are oaks and beeches whose trunks have a diameter of more than one meter. The trees 'walk' at the edge of the drifting sand plains in the Panbos. The wind has blown away the sand between the roots.

Bornia is part of a nature reserve that consists of three parts: Heidestein, Bornia and Noordhout, which are located from west to east respectively. Together this forms an area of 642 hectares, the largest contiguous area of the Utrecht Landscape, of which Bornia is the largest at 289 hectares.

The lakes around Houten offer diverse natural features. You can find unique landscapes like the Drowned Forest, a recreational forest with dead trees that serve as a water storage facility. Bosmeer Pond in Utrechtse Heuvelrug is nestled within sand dunes, while Heidestein Forest Lake offers a fairytale environment, especially with its beautiful fall colors. Rietplas Houten, a man-made recreational lake, features beaches and vibrant, colorful houses along its shores.
Yes, several lakes are great for families. Rietplas Houten is highly suitable, offering shallow swimming areas, a playground, and ample space for outdoor activities like picnicking. Other family-friendly spots include Bosmeer Pond in Utrechtse Heuvelrug, the Drowned Forest, Bornia Estate, and Pond Fourprong, all of which are noted for their family-friendly environments.
You can enjoy a variety of outdoor activities. Rietplas Houten is popular for swimming, sailing, and stand-up paddleboarding (SUP), with ice skating possible in winter. The surrounding areas offer extensive networks for hiking and cycling. For more structured routes, you can explore hiking trails around Houten, road cycling routes, or even MTB trails.
The best time depends on your preferred activities. For swimming and water sports at Rietplas Houten, the warmer months are ideal. If you enjoy vibrant autumn foliage, Heidestein Forest Lake is particularly beautiful in the fall. Winter offers the unique opportunity for ice skating on Rietplas Houten if conditions allow.
Yes, Rietplas Houten stands out with its colorful houses along the shore, sometimes referred to as 'Klein Curaçao in Houten,' adding a unique architectural charm. The Drowned Forest is also distinctive, featuring a landscape of dead trees resulting from its design as a water storage facility.
